PABX Centrals


Are capable of working independent or in a network. The connection to the public line can be made through analogical lines or ISDN.


Advantages


  • Maintenance and Administration Services made by our specialists to assure a permanent technical support;

  • Automatic call routing without human intervention;

  • Taxing software implementation, which allows you to get a detailed report about each station's costs;

  • outgoing calls restrictions;

  • lowering costs by monitoring the outgoing calls and optimizing the outgoing routes through the LCR ( least cost routing ) mechanism;

  • the possibility of installing adapters for the mobile networks access;

  • telephone password encryption and the usage of the password on any telephone terminal;

  • voice mail.



The system makes the connections between the telephones inside the company but also with outside lines (PSTN). If the receiver is busy and doesn't answear, the call is automatically diverted to the voice mail service.

DECT



Unlike the analogical cordless phones, the DECT (Digital Enhanced Cordless Telecommunications) system on the principle of of wireless digital network. It's utility is renowned among companies and even further.

While the GSM system is optimized for long distance calls, DECT is specially designed for tighter areas with a large number of users, thus making it ideal for the business enviroment.

The standards of this technology are the most advanced thus offering the possibility of implementing a large number of services ( voice, fax, data, multimedia) while maintaining at the same time the highest level of interoperability.

The benefits of using this system are obvious and generate a competitive advantage to the company by improving the internal communication process. Also the initial cost of implementation and the operating one are some of the lowest.

VoIP

At the moment the Internet and mobile phones have become indispensable to any business with a tendency to integrate both voice and data into one service.

IP telephony, also known as VoIP (Voice over IP), is a major technology innovation which already started to change the way people communicate.

This communication solutions are enjoying a special interest from companies which have implemented local networks of computers and Internet access.

It's advantages are most promising: very low costs and versatile functions (caller ID, voicemail, video calls,fax to e-mail, pc to pc calls, pc to telephone calls).

Because this technology uses the Internet global network and not a normal telephone line the calling costs are much lower.

The person making the call can be anywhere on the globe and can talk to people in any country. The call can be made using a pc with an Internet connection or a VoIP hardware device. In this case the caller uses one of the methods described above and the receiver answers on a normal telephone.

The voice signal is delivered most of the way as IP packages through the Internet. It is then transformed in a voice signal and introduced into the telephone network through a gateway or telephone switch equipment. The VoIP hardware devices look a lot like regular telephones and allow a Internet connection and international calls without the use of a computer. The cost of a call through the Internet is a few times lower that on a traditional phone line. At the ends of a VoIP call you can have pcs, telephones, VoIP hardware, or faxes in any combination.

The telephone's connection to the Internet is made exactly as the one of the computer (routable IP adress, subnet mask, default gateway).
